I work in a call centre but as admin. My employer has told me today as of today I will need to now change to telephone based role. I suffer from rheumatoid arthritis and explained the pain in my jaw is horrific, if I talk all day I will be in agony. It’s already really restricted and may need operating in. They have nothing else for me but my job has gone. Do I leave but I can’t afford too or do I speak to HR?

    Hi @debbielkl Welcome to the community

    Dont just leave, if your job no longer exists and they do not have a suitable alternative then this is a redundancy situation

    If the job they have offered you is not suitable due to your disability this could possibly be dealt with as a medical dismissal

    Are you in a union if so seek their advice or the advice from ACAS

    You can also speak to HR and seek their advice on the company policy relating to change in role, redundancy and medical dismissal

    Hi again 

    Unfortunately employers are able to change your job role and often do if there has been a restructure or maybe the service they provide has changed so the role is no longer there.

    If the role no longer exists then this is a redundant position and they must follow their redundancy policy

    Some employers change just aspects of the role add on or take off some of the duties and again they can do this with the required notice to employees

    Companies have to be able to do this or they could never move forward

    You are doing the best thing by getting advice from OH and it sounds like the company is reasonable so I am sure you will all come to an agreement
